Handover from Pell to Varna: the Orchana events table is now partitioned by month, with a scheduled job creating next month's partition on the 25th. Old partitions past 13 months are detached, not dropped, pending retention sign-off. Access to the detach job is role-gated. The partition maintenance procedure is documented on the internal page below.

dashboard of bafof-hafog = https://confluence.lumiclabs.internal/display/browse/display/6a09a20a

**Mgmt Meeting Minutes — Retiring the Brightline Range**

Quick recap for sales leads at Fenholt Supplies: we agreed to retire the Brightline fixture range by year-end. Remaining stock moves to clearance pricing next month, and accounts on standing orders get migrated to the Lumetta range. Trade-in incentives were approved in principle. The confidential note on next steps sits just below.

board note of bajof-bajeg: The pricing group signed off on a budget of $13.4 million for Project Sildor. The renewal with Lamixek Holdings closes at $48.9 million a year, 49 percent above the last contract.

# Timezone Limits — Brightmoor Report Exports

Heads up, support folks: exports always render in the workspace timezone, not the requester's. Customers asking "why is my Monday missing rows" almost always hit the day-boundary shift. We cap how far back exports can reach and how many zone conversions one job will do, mostly to keep the Kestrel workers sane. The current caps are listed below.

constants for bawif-kawif:
QUOTAS = {
    "ulaael": 5,
    "holael": 10,
}